How to Convert Shekel (Hebrew) to Short Ton (US)
To convert Shekel (Hebrew) to Short Ton (US), multiply the value in Shekel (Hebrew) by the conversion factor 0.00001257.

Understanding the Shekel: A Historical Unit of Weight
The shekel, an ancient unit of weight, holds significant importance in historical and archaeological studies. Originating from the ancient Near East, it was primarily used in the Hebrew and Babylonian systems of measurement. The shekel was not a fixed weight; its value varied over time and among different cultures. Typically, a shekel weighed about 11 to 14 grams, acting as a benchmark for trade and commerce.
In the ancient world, the shekel served as a standard unit for measuring precious metals like silver and gold. This provided a consistent measure for trade, ensuring fair exchanges. The use of the shekel in trade highlights its dual role as both a weight and a form of currency, thereby influencing economic systems of its time.
Beyond commerce, the shekel was utilized in religious contexts, particularly in Jewish traditions. The shekel weight was crucial in calculating tithes and offerings, underscoring its cultural and religious significance. By integrating the shekel into various societal facets, ancient civilizations established a common understanding of weight and value, facilitating coherent economic and cultural practices.
The Shekel's Historical Journey: From Antiquity to the Modern Era
The history of the shekel traces back to ancient Mesopotamia, where it was first recorded around 3000 BCE. Initially, it served as a weight measure in the Sumerian and Akkadian civilizations, reflecting the need for standardized trade practices. As societies evolved, so did the shekel, adapting to the requirements of expanding economies and diverse cultural landscapes.
During the Bronze Age, the shekel became integral to the Babylonian and Hebrew cultures. The Babylonians pegged the shekel to the weight of barley, standardizing its use across the region. Concurrently, in ancient Israel, the shekel was embedded in religious and legal systems, as evidenced by biblical references that underscore its ritualistic importance.
Throughout history, the shekel underwent transformation influenced by political, economic, and cultural shifts. The Persian Empire, for instance, adopted the shekel, modifying its weight to suit imperial standards. This adaptability highlights the shekel's enduring relevance and its capacity to transcend cultural boundaries, maintaining its utility over millennia.

Understanding the Short Ton (US): A Comprehensive Guide
The Short Ton (US), often simply referred to as a ton, is a unit of weight commonly used in the United States. It is equivalent to 2,000 pounds or about 907.185 kilograms. As a unit of mass, the short ton plays a significant role in various industries, especially those dealing with heavy materials like construction and agriculture.
The short ton is distinct from the long ton (also known as the British ton or imperial ton), which is equivalent to 2,240 pounds. This difference highlights the importance of understanding the specific context in which the term "ton" is used. In international trade, such distinctions are crucial, especially in sectors that rely heavily on accurate weight measurements, such as mining and shipping.
In scientific terms, weight is a measure of the force exerted by gravity on an object, and the short ton provides a practical way to quantify this force for large-scale applications. The choice of using the short ton over other units like kilograms or pounds often depends on the geographic location and industry standards. Understanding these standards is vital for professionals working in logistics, manufacturing, and other fields that require precise weight measurements.
The Evolution of the Short Ton: From Origins to Modern-Day Use
The short ton has its origins in the United States, where it was established as a standard unit of weight in the late 19th century. Its creation was driven by the need for a consistent and reliable measurement system that could facilitate trade and economic growth. The short ton's definition as 2,000 pounds was intended to simplify calculations and align with the U.S. customary units of measurement.
Throughout the 20th century, the short ton became increasingly prominent as the United States expanded its industrial capabilities. It was widely adopted in sectors like steel production and coal mining, where the ability to measure large quantities of materials efficiently was essential. The short ton's role in these industries underscores its importance in American economic history.
The distinction between the short ton and other tonnage units, such as the long ton and the metric ton, has been a subject of international negotiation and standardization. The metrication movement of the late 20th century saw many countries adopt the metric ton, yet the short ton remains a staple in the United States. Its continued use reflects the country's commitment to its traditional measurement systems.
